The 4-H year starts on October 1, and ends September 30, of the following year.
4-H enrollment is open all year, however, in order to participate in the Buffalo County Fair, youth must be signed up for projects by April 1st. We encourage all current 4-H members to complete enrollment forms by November 1.
There are two sides of the Buffalo County enrollment form. The first page provides spaces for your personal information such as name, address, age and grade, which projects you are enrolling in for this 4-H year, and for your parent contact information.
The second page contains information regarding liability and behavioral expectation agreements. All 4-H members and their parent/guardian must read and sign this page.
You are not considered to be officially enrolled in the Buffalo County 4-H Program until both sides of the form have been read, completed and signed.

You are able to switch 4-H clubs in Buffalo County. If you decide to switch to a new 4-H club, please do the following:
- First contact the leader of your current 4-H club and let them know of your plans.
- Then contact the leader of the club you wish to join.
- You will not need to complete a new enrollment form.
- Contact the Buffalo County UW-Extension Office (608-685-6256) and let us know of the switch so we can update our computer records.
